WebThe physical background of Crystal-TRIM has been described in the papers given in the reference list 1) below. The main applications of the code have been investigations on chan-neling e ects and defect evolution during ion bombardment. The present version can be used to calculate as-implanted range and damage distributions as a function of depth. WebApr 29, 2024 · Antifungal Susceptibility Testing: Current Approaches.
